Ukraine war: Poland says missile deaths an unfortunate incident
Tuesday afternoon marked the first time a NATO country has been directly hit during the 9-month-long invasion of Ukraine, when a missile landed in the Polish village of Przewodow, killing two people on a farm. Now, this happened at “roughly the same time as Russia launched its biggest wave of missile attacks on Ukrainian cities in more than a month” leading people to suspect that this could have been a Russian attack, but despite the Polish Foreign Ministry initially describing the missile as “Russian-made,” it’s actually not known who fired the missile, or precisely where it was fired from.
(Note: Both Russian and Ukrainian forces have used Russian-made weapons during the conflict, with Ukraine deploying Russian-made missiles as part of its air defense system.)
Joe Biden said that “preliminary information suggested it was “unlikely” the missile was fired from within Russia,” Polish President Andrzej Duda has said “there are no signs of an intentional attack,” and Russian spokesman Dmitry Peskov accused western states of a “hysterical reaction” (sounds like a reporter from the 2000s describing teenage girls at a concert) so at this stage, there are no clear answers.
*UPDATE: Right before I went to send this the BBC reported that:
“The Nato chief Jens Stoltenberg says the blast in Poland late on Tuesday was likely to have been caused by Ukraine's air defence systems.”
In the meantime, the G-7 met on the sidelines of the G-20 summit (🎶like a G6🎶) in Bali, issued a statement condemning the “the barbaric missile attacks” that Russia inflicted on Ukrainian cities and infrastructure on Tuesday, and offered their full support to Poland. The Grammy Noms are in
And Beyoncé is the woman of the moment! She’s now been nominated 88 times - tied for the most nominations ever with - guess who? Her hubby Jay-Z. Beyoncé was nominated in NINE different categories this year, while our boy Harry also SLAYED these nominations too, grabbing 6 noms!!!! Also, a cool new update to the Grammy’s is that there is now a category for Songwriter of the Year (this feels… like it should have been added earlier) but better late than never!
